Recently, Lewis Hamilton made it clear that he will not be driving for the team in 2025.

Lewis Hamilton’s announcement that he won’t be driving for his team in 2025 marks a significant moment in the

world of Formula 1. As one of the most decorated and iconic drivers in the sport’s history, Hamilton’s decisions

reverberate throughout the racing community and beyond.

Speculation and anticipation had been mounting regarding Hamilton’s future in Formula 1, especially given his

illustrious career and the inevitable question of when he might choose to retire. However, the confirmation of his

departure still comes as a surprise to many fans and pundits alike.

Hamilton’s impact on Formula 1 transcends mere statistics. Beyond his record-breaking number of race wins and

championship titles, he has become a cultural icon, using his platform to advocate for social justice issues,

environmental sustainability, and diversity in motorsport. His absence from the grid in 2025 will undoubtedly leave

a void not only in terms of his racing prowess but also in terms of his influential voice on and off the track.

For his team, Hamilton’s departure presents both challenges and opportunities. On one hand, they lose a driver of

unparalleled skill and experience, whose feedback and performance have been instrumental in their success. On the

other hand, it opens up the possibility for fresh talent to step into the spotlight and for the team to redefine its

identity in a post-Hamilton era.

For fans, Hamilton’s decision will likely evoke a range of emotions. There will be sadness at the thought of no longer

seeing him compete, but also excitement at the prospect of new rivalries and narratives unfolding in his absence.

Hamilton’s departure marks the end of an era, but it also heralds the beginning of a new chapter in the ever-evolving

story of Formula 1.

As for Hamilton himself, his future beyond Formula 1 remains uncertain. Whether he chooses to pursue other

interests, continue his activism, or perhaps even explore opportunities in other racing series, one thing is certain: his

impact on Formula 1 and the world at large will endure for years to come.
